The largest drinking water storage facility is the Riyadh Strategic Water Reservoir, with a total capacity of 4,790,000 cubic metres, located in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, and verified on 22 September 2023.


The decision to construct the 4,790,000m³ SWCC's Riyadh Strategic Water Reservoir facility is motivated by the imperative to mitigate water scarcity and ensure a dependable water supply for Riyadh. This facility plays a crucial role in augmenting the economic value of desalination through renewable energy, such as solar desalination, by storing surplus desalinated water for consumption during periods when energy sources are unavailable. By setting a new record for the world's largest drinking water storage tank facility, the project addresses the escalating water demand, fortifies water security, and establishes strategic and easily accessible water reserves. The record-breaking achievement is evaluated based on the facility's storage capacity, comparing it to similar facilities worldwide.
